Lindsay Lohan's legal problems seem a long way from ending, but that's not stopping momager (mother slash manager) Dina from delivering her a massive blow in the form of a planned memoir, it has emerged.

TMZ claims to have it on very good authority that Dina Lohan has written a book and is now shopping it around town.

Not only that, but she's also dished all the saucy details of her daughter's troubled life in it, the e-zine says. It also claims to have seen a page from said planned memoir – and it's not pretty.

“I blamed her friends, her career and her handlers for an (sic) newfound lifestyle of partying excessively. Drinking, drugging and behaving irresponsibly became Lindsay's way of daily living – and it tore me up inside,” Dina reportedly wrote in a draft for the prologue to the book, which she's now showing publishers.

She also says she couldn't force Lindsay to move from Los Angeles back to New York, and thus take her away from this world of self-destruction, because that would have meant killing her acting dreams.

“How could I deny my daughter the chance of a lifetime? How could I hold Lindsay back from her dream of becoming an actress? So, I listened to others and sent my daughter to Hollywood with a few pieces of luggage and a chaperone,” Dina writes.

Dina doesn't blame herself for anything that went wrong in Lindsay's life. She thinks being her mother and her manager made it impossible for her to make the right decision – at the right time.

After the initial report, Lohan's publicist issued a statement to TMZ to say that Dina hasn't written any book but, if she will, it will not expose her child's troubled past.

“Dina has not written a book yet and has not signed with a publisher. If and when that happens, her book would certainly show the utmost compassion for her children. Right now her focus is on the well-being of her family,” the rep says.

TMZ agrees: Dina hasn't written a book, she's written a prologue to a book for which she's trying to land a publisher first.

If a deal is signed, the book will come, the report adds.
